📣 New Preprint!
Here we use bees as a model to study how a temperate phage-bacteria pair interact in the gut and how antibiotics change these interactions.
The take home? Phage can play a major role in shaping how gut microbiomes respond to antibiotic perturbation!

A 20 year study on 2 NIH diversity programs in Science Advances shows they doubled undergrads' odds of getting a Ph.D.
That is, before the funding for those programs and for the study itself was terminated last year:
